History and development:
Online poker appeared in the late 1990s because of breakthroughs in technology additionally the net. The initial online poker area,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in the first 2000s that online poker experienced exponential development, mainly because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the most significant cause of the immense popularity of internet poker is its ease of access. People can log on to their favorite on-line poker platforms anytime, from anywhere, employing their computers or mobile devices. This convenience features drawn a diverse player base, including leisure players to specialists, causing the quick growth of online poker.
Benefits of Internet Poker:
On-line poker provides a number of benefits over conventional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it provides a broader variety of online game choices, including various poker alternatives and stakes, catering toward tastes and spending plans of kinds of people. Additionally, internet poker areas tend to be available 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of real casino working hours. Additionally, on the web systems frequently provide appealing bonuses, respect programs, additionally the capacity to play numerous tables simultaneously, enhancing the overall video gaming knowledge.
Challenges and Regulation:
Whilst online poker business flourishes, it faces difficulties in the shape of regulation and safety issues. Governments globally have implemented differing levels of legislation to guard players and stop fraudulent activities. In addition, on-line poker platforms require sturdy protection steps to guard people' individual and financial information, guaranteeing a safe playing environment.
Economic and Personal Influence:
The growth of online poker has received a significant economic influence globally. Internet poker platforms produce substantial revenue through rake costs, event entry costs, and advertising. This income has generated job creation and investments into the gaming industry. Moreover, online poker has contributed to an increase in taxation revenue for governing bodies in which its controlled, promoting community solutions.
From a social point of view, on-line poker features fostered a worldwide poker community, bridging geographical barriers. Players from diverse experiences and areas can communicate and participate, cultivating a sense of camaraderie. On-line poker has additionally played a vital role in promoting the game's popularity and attracting brand new people, leading to the development of this poker business in general.
